Write Ecommerce Product Descriptions That Sell

Product descriptions play a vital role in ecommerce. They impact buying decisions by painting the product and its benefits. A compelling product description can boost sales and strengthen customer loyalty. To generate descriptions that truly resonate, consider these key elements:

* **Specifically Define Your Target Audience**: Know who you're writing to and tailor your language and tone accordingly.

* **Showcase Benefits, Not Just Features**: Illustrate how the product will benefit the customer's problems or satisfy their needs.

* **UseCompelling Language**: Create a picture with your copyright and stir the reader's imagination.

* **Include Keywords**: Optimize your descriptions for search engines by using relevant keywords that your target audience might use.

* **Ensure It Concise and Scannable**: Use short paragraphs, bullet points, and headings to make your descriptions easy to understand.

Maximize Your Ecommerce Product Page for Search Engines

Your ecommerce product pages are more than just online storefronts—they're essential gateways to conversions. To attract customers and increase sales, you need to ensure your product pages rank top in search engine results.

Here are some key strategies to fine-tune your ecommerce product pages for search engines:

* **Conduct Keyword Research**: Before you even start writing, explore relevant keywords that potential customers might use when searching for products like yours. Utilize keyword research tools to uncover high-volume, low-competition keywords that align with your product offerings.

* **Craft Compelling Titles and Descriptions**: Your product titles and descriptions are the first impressions you make on search engines and potential buyers. Make them concise, informative, and captivating. Include your target keywords naturally throughout these elements.

* **Optimize Product Images**: High-quality product images are essential for grabbing attention and boosting conversions. Ensure your images are high-resolution, well-lit, and visually appealing. Use descriptive file names that include relevant keywords.

* **Build High-Quality Content**: Go beyond simply listing product features. Create informative and compelling content that helps potential customers understand the advantages of your products.

By implementing these SEO best practices, you can enhance the visibility of your ecommerce product pages in search results, attract more qualified traffic, and ultimately boost sales.
